>> >> There are three representatives to the NRO NC/ASO AC from the AFRINIC
>> >> Service region. Two are elected by the community with staggered
>> >> three-year terms, while the third is appointed by the AFRINIC Board.
>> >>
>> >>
>> >> I am pleased to inform you that the AFRINIC Board has appointed Ms.
>> >> Fiona Asonga as its representative to the NRO NC/ASO AC, for a one year
>> >> term from 1st January to 31st December 2017. She will be replacing Mr.
>> >> Mark Elkins who was the Board’s appointee during 2015 and 2016, and
>> >> continues to serve until 31 December 2016.  Fiona was previously
>> elected
>> >> by the community, for a term ending on 31st December 2016, and will
>> >> change from a community-elected seat to a Board-appointed seat on 1st
>> >> January 2017.
>> >>
>> >>
>> >> You will recall that the community elected Mr. Omo Oaiya at the AIS
>> >> summit in Gaborone for a three year term that runs from 1st January
>> 2017
>> >> to 31 December 2019. Mr. Douglas Onyango is the other representative
>> >> elected by the community and his tenure will expire on 31 December
>> 2017.
